While Hinge first began by showing you Facebook associates of pals, their algorithm has been getting smarter and smarter, and is now capable of surpass friends of pals as a predictor of compatibility. This means you will not be matched with someone all incorrect for you just because you might have a mutual acquaintance. Rather, Hinge will assist you to get to know the opposite person extra deeply by having users answer prompts to level out off character and interests. Some 15% of U.S. adults say they’re single and on the lookout for a committed relationship or informal dates. Among them, most say they are dissatisfied with their relationship lives, according to the survey, which was conducted in October 2019 – earlier than the coronavirus pandemic shook up the relationship scene. Where there could be money—or a minimum of the smell of it—there are additionally startups. In the United States, a minimal of 50 relationship companies have been based between 2019 and 2021, based on knowledge from Crunchbase. While that price hasn’t changed much over the past decade, the whole amount of funding has grown. These new startups characterize a few contemporary concepts within the courting space, and a hope that the subsequent courting unicorn might emerge after a year of isolation.
